Will a chemical drain cleaner fix this myself?

Store-bought chemical cleaners can sometimes clear minor clogs, but they often just push the blockage further down the line rather than removing it, and repeated use can damage older pipes. For a persistent or full blockage, mechanical clearing is usually more effective.

Can tree roots really get into a drain line?

Yes — roots are drawn to the moisture inside drain and sewer lines and can enter through small cracks or joints, gradually causing blockages or pipe damage. This is a common cause of recurring main line backups.
